Tailor-made solutions from meurer
interpack Hall 15 Stand A21/B22
 
Everything from one source - meurer Verpackungssysteme
of Fürstenau delivers complete final packaging lines from
planning through to commissioning. Every product is different
and demands an individual solution. At the interpack 2008
meurer is presenting more new developments than ever
before.
 
The new meurer CM/HHS high speed horizontal flow wrapping machine in balcony construction groups beverage packages fully automatically and
subsequently packs them in a full wrap with
shrink film. In the process, the CM/HHS is
convincing with its performance of 160 packs per minute.
The products are supplied from a meurer CM/HSP horizontal buffer.

The new meurer CM/TFS 60 is a combined tray packaging and film wrapping machine. PET bottles, glass bottles, jars, tins or other cylindrical products are grouped and packed selectively in trays with and without film wrapping cover or only packed in film. Performance range: 60 packs/min on one lane; 120 packs/min on two lanes.

The meurer CM/PP Pick & Place Top Loader with integrated carton erector fills cartons with tray packs, whereby intermediate cardboard layers are placed between the packs. The cartons are subsequently sealed with adhesive tape and placed on pallets by the meurer CM/PPA Portal Palletiser. The telescopic gripper column is a new feature on the CM/PPA.

The meurer CM/PP Pick & Place Top Loader with integrated tray erectorr packs bars of a wide variety of sizes. The bars (tubular bag packages) are grouped in different formations and placed in a previously erected tray. The lid is sealed subsequently by means of hot glue.

In addition, the fully automatic CMW/AL 40-B L-sealer and meurer’s tried and tested CM/SB 60-B Stretch Bander were advanced.
